Men Are More Likely to Use Psychological Manipulation In a Relationship
One of the most intriguing dark psychology facts about men’s relationships is their tendency to use manipulation tactics, whether consciously or unconsciously.
Some common manipulation techniques include:

Gaslighting:
It makes the partner doubt their own beliefs, ideas, and reality.
Even the evidence is presented. Unconsciously, it can be an attempt to protect or avoid himself or herself from emotional harm, but conscious practice can be dangerous.
Silent treatment:
Silent treatment means ignoring your partner to gain control.

Negging:
In dark psychology, Negging is determined as one of the most powerful manipulation techniques.
In this, the manipulator makes negative comments or backhanded compliments to undermine someone’s self-esteem and confidence.

Source: Pexels
This makes the person insecure and compelled to seek validation from the man negging. It’s a power play, aiming to shift the balance of control in the interactions.

Mirroring Behaviour:
In dark psychology, mirroring is perceived as a powerful manipulation tactic where an individual imitates another person’s body language, speech patterns, and even emotional expressions such as smiling, shyness, etc.
